## What Is the Mantis Being?

The Mantis Being is often described as an otherworldly entity with the appearance of a giant praying mantis — serene, observant, and exuding an almost hypnotic calm. While accounts vary, many describe it as a guide or teacher, offering insights into the nature of reality, consciousness, and our place in the universe. Whether you see it as a spiritual figure, a cosmic traveler, or simply a metaphor for higher awareness, the Mantis Being invites us to slow down and observe the world with intention.

## How Does the Mantis Being Teach Us to Be Present?

One of the most consistent themes in encounters with the Mantis Being is its emphasis on presence. The mantis, both in nature and in legend, is known for its stillness and focus. It doesn’t rush. It waits. It watches. In a world that glorifies busyness, this is a radical act. The Mantis Being reminds us that being fully present allows us to see more clearly, react more thoughtfully, and connect more deeply with others. ## What Can We Learn About Patience from the Mantis Being?

Patience is not passive waiting — it’s active trust. The Mantis Being embodies this kind of patience. In stories and visions, it rarely intervenes or forces outcomes. Instead, it waits for the right moment, trusting the unfolding of events. This mirrors our own lives: trying to rush growth, relationships, or healing often leads to frustration. The Mantis Being teaches that patience is a form of faith — in ourselves, in others, and in the natural rhythms of life.

## How Does the Mantis Being Help Us Understand Transformation?

The praying mantis undergoes metamorphosis — a powerful symbol of transformation. The Mantis Being, in many interpretations, guides us through our own inner transformations. It encourages us to shed old identities, beliefs, and habits that no longer serve us. Just as the mantis molts to grow, we too must sometimes let go of what’s comfortable to evolve. The key takeaway? Transformation is not always comfortable, but it is necessary for growth.
